impl crate::PlaidClient {
    /**Create user

This endpoint should be called for each of your end users before they begin a Plaid Check or Income flow, or a Multi-Item Link flow. This provides you a single token to access all data associated with the user. You should only create one per end user.

The `consumer_report_user_identity` object must be present in order to create a Plaid Check Consumer Report for a user. If it is not provided during the `/user/create` call, it can be added later by calling `/user/update`.

If you call the endpoint multiple times with the same `client_user_id`, the first creation call will succeed and the rest will fail with an error message indicating that the user has been created for the given `client_user_id`.

Ensure that you store the `user_token` along with your user's identifier in your database, as it is not possible to retrieve a previously created `user_token`.

See endpoint docs at <https://plaid.com/docs/api/users/#usercreate>.*/
    pub fn user_create(
        &self,
        client_user_id: &str,
    ) -> FluentRequest<'_, UserCreateRequest> {
        FluentRequest {
            client: self,
            params: UserCreateRequest {
                client_user_id: client_user_id.to_owned(),
                consumer_report_user_identity: None,
                end_customer: None,
            },
        }
    }
}
